Output 34f5a43d01ea155a07f92f74f58487848e909ae5aa882f0ca43c6b9f59de9653:0

value
50304523
script pubkey
OP_0 OP_PUSHBYTES_20 fa9e3a819fb3cff6f541b2d741dcf92c94afd87b
address
bc1ql20r4qvlk08lda2pktt5rh8e9j22lkrmesct3t
transaction
34f5a43d01ea155a07f92f74f58487848e909ae5aa882f0ca43c6b9f59de9653
confirmations
382030
spent
true